Regarding the defeat in the re-election of the Hiroshima constituency of the House of Councilors, former Liberal Democratic Party chairman Fumio Kishida said, "It is more severe than expected and should not be diminished due to local circumstances." He expressed his intention to put together recommendations for the restoration of the party's trust.

At a faction meeting, Mr. Kishida apologized for the defeat in the re-election of the Hiroshima constituency of the House of Councilors. The issue of money has been reported, and the party has been harshly viewed. "



He pointed out that "if this result is a regional situation in Hiroshima, we must take it as a national issue without diminishing it," and made recommendations for restoring the trust of the party for the next House of Representatives election. I showed the idea to put it together.



On the other hand, Mr. Kishida told reporters after the meeting, "I have not changed my mind. I would like to challenge if I have a chance, but now it is a fight against the new coronavirus and the administration I am in a position to support and strive for the lives and livelihoods of the people. "
